Modifying the Contents of the Configuration Database

Use the modify command to change entities in the configuration database. For example, to change the user smithj entry in the database, enter:

CM Edit> modify user smithj

You can also change the values of actions, events, filters and scan profiles. This is discussed in the Chapter Setting Up the ENS Components.

To clear a field in the configuration database, enter only the \ character. If the field you are clearing is a required field, you are prompted for a value, with the current value listed as the default response.
